Pesticide usage has increased to fulfil agricultural demand. Pesticides such as organophosphorus pesticides (OPPs) are ubiquitous in world food production. Their widespread unavoidable detrimental consequences for humans, wildlife, water, and soil environments. Hence, the development of more convenient efficient pesticide residue (PR) detection methods is paramount importance. Visual detecting approaches have acquired a lot interest among different sensing systems due inherent advantages terms simplicity, speed, sensitivity, eco-friendliness. Furthermore, various detections been proven enable real-life PR surveillance environment water. Fluorometric (FL), colourimetric (CL), enzyme-inhibition (EI) techniques emerged viable options. These technologies do not need complex operating processes or specialist equipment, simple colour change allows visual monitoring result. on-site water environments discussed this paper. This paper further reviews prior research on integration CL, FL, EI-based with nanoparticles (NPs), quantum dots (QDs), metal-organic frameworks (MOFs). Smartphone PRs also reviewed. Finally, conventional nanoparticle (NPs) based strategies compared.
